Ah, see none of your icons work just yet and the front page doesn't make it very clear what's going on. It's obvious that there are things going on, I just had no clue what.
If its intended to be a search engine of sorts, it might be an idea to subscribe to the Google paradigm of simplicity - they didn't destroy every other search engine simply with the amount of data that they aggregated, it was very much due to the fact that they broke the mold of making every search engine a 'portal'. If I haven't searched for something, how can it know what I might want to see on the front page?
If you intend to keep it the way it is, you should probably consider adding some kind of header in there that lets me know, 'Recent Searches', 'Trending Topics', or whatever the basis of the initial information is. A blurb somewhere letting us know what Infolizer is would be extremely helpful too.
From a third party perspective, my first reaction was exactly as I posted. Looks neat, but no clue what it was.
I like the structure of the results, they're a lot more professional looking than most web sites I see attempted now a days, but I think VI has a point. You need larger margins between each entry, the eye wants somewhere to rest while trying to digest all the content, and there's no break given.
Looks like an excellent start though!
